
Wed Sep 18 15:30:59 UTC 2024: ## Yogi Adityanath hails Modi as “charioteer” of India’s progress on PM’s birthday
**VARANASI:**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ath lauded Prime Minister Narendra Modi as the “charioteer” of India’s “Amrit Kaal” on Tuesday, marking Modi’s 74th birthday. The CM, who was in the PM’s Lok Sabha constituency, celebrated the occasion with a special puja and havan at the Kashi Vishwanath Temple. He later distributed ‘prasad,’ including a 74-kg laddu, on the temple premises.
Adityanath highlighted Modi’s leadership in transforming India from a “backward nation” to the fifth-largest economy in just ten years. He predicted India’s rise to the third-largest economy within the next three years. The CM attributed this success to Modi’s tireless efforts, visionary leadership, and initiatives like ‘Ek Bharat, Shreshtha Bharat.’
He also launched the ‘Swachhata Hi Seva’ campaign-2024 at the Rudraksha Convention Centre in Varanasi, emphasizing the importance of cleanliness in rural areas. Adityanath praised the transformative changes in Kashi since 2014, highlighting the restoration of temples and the recognition of India’s heritage.
The CM further outlined the progress made in various sectors under Modi’s leadership, including infrastructure development, improved connectivity, and the implementation of the PM Vishwakarma Yojana. He also highlighted the government’s focus on empowering artisans and promoting rural self-sufficiency.
Adityanath concluded by launching the ‘Vidya Shakti Yojana’ in partnership with IIT-Chennai, aiming to improve education in 104 council schools in Varanasi. He also inaugurated smart classrooms in 1,143 council schools, showcasing the government’s commitment to educational development.
